Description

1996 CATERHAM 7 - 40TH ANNIVERSARY - No. 1 of 67

A rare and highly collectible Caterham Seven 40th Anniversary Edition, finished in stunning Ruby Pearlescent with a Silver bonnet stripe and black coachline. This particular example is plaque number 1 of just 67 produced, making it the very first of this exclusive anniversary series.

Originally showcased at the 1996 Motorshow, this factory-built example remains in exceptional condition, boasting an enviable specification and an illustrious history.

Model History
Unveiled at the 1957 London Motorshow, the Super Seven quickly became an icon of lightweight, high-performance motoring. To celebrate 40 years of continuous production, Caterham introduced the 40th Anniversary Special Edition between 1996 and 1998. Each of the 67 units built featured the distinctive Ruby Pearlescent paint, Silver bonnet stripe, and black coachline, along with an individually numbered dashboard plaque.

Buyers had the choice of either a Rover K-Series engine or the more powerful 2. 0L Vauxhall unit, making this one of the most expensive Caterhams of its time, with prices north of £20, 000 in period. Today, the 40th Anniversary Edition remains a sought-after collector’s piece, with this particular example being the most significant of them all – the very first one ever built.

Engine
This 40th Anniversary Edition was factory-fitted with the highly desirable 2. 0L Vauxhall ‘Redtop’ engine, producing 175 BHP via Twin Weber Carburettors. The De Dion rear axle and 5-speed gearbox ensure thrilling performance, true to the Caterham philosophy of lightweight, engaging driving dynamics.
